How NFL betting sites work in practice

Understanding how a typical NFL betting site, also known as a sportsbook, works can eliminate much of the uncertainty for newbies. On both desktop and mobile devices, these platforms provide a structured environment where users view upcoming matches, browse available markets, and make choices based on their predictions about how the games will play out.

NFL betting sites create a structured space for users to watch games, browse markets, and make selections on desktop and mobile devices. The process begins with creating an account, which requires basic details such as name, address and date of birth. The platforms then perform identity and age verification by uploading documents or checking a database. Once approved, users add game tokens using supported payment methods and can immediately explore available markets.

Weekly NFL game reports typically appear early and are adjusted as news develops, including injury reports, coaching announcements, weather changes and public interest. Interfaces update spreads, totals and performance metrics in real time, helping users understand how numbers are changing before play begins.

Geolocation technology verifies that users are physically located in regulated states before accessing markets. This ensures compliance with state and federal regulations in jurisdictions such as New Jersey, Pennsylvania and Michigan.

Major markets for NFL game results

Classic game odds appear for nearly every matchup on the NFL betting site, representing the easiest way to use professional football predictions. In these markets, the focus is on which team will win and by what margin.

Score markets appear on almost every NFL game and are the easiest way to get predictions. Money Line Selection Please select the team that you think will win outright. Favorites show lower potential earnings, while underdogs show positive odds that reflect higher payouts if they win.

The point spread provides an opportunity to balance out mismatched teams. For the selection to be successful, the unit listed at -3.5 must win by four or more points. Underdogs with positive spreads can live up to expectations by winning outright or losing by margin. This format allows for interaction even when the matches seem uneven.

Line Movement and Alternatives

Lines often shift between early week first games and Sunday games due to changes in defenders, weather conditions or the benefits of rest after Thursday games. Platforms update these adjustments in real time and often include tools to compare price ranges. Alternative spreads provide additional options by allowing users to choose higher or lower margins on adjusted numbers.

Combined score lines appear as totals next to each NFL slate, representing projections for both teams' combined totals. These markets offer interactions tied to offensive and defensive performance rather than which team will win, and allow users to place over/under bets on the overall score.

Total is a forecast of the total score of both teams. Users make over/under selections based on the published number. Outdoor winter games may see lower final scores, while dome games with high-powered offenses often see higher projections.

Alternate totals allow users to adjust thresholds for higher or lower numbers. The results for each team are based on how many points one team will score, regardless of the opponent. Quarter and half totals divide the game into smaller segments, allowing for greater flexibility.

Outcomes vary depending on offensive style, pace of play, underlying injuries, short preparation week, winter conditions and familiarity with the division. These variables explain why early-season volatility often takes on more predictable patterns as defenses adapt.

Futures are long-term prediction markets that appear on NFL betting sites several months before Week 1 and remain active throughout the football season. These markets attract fans from the offseason through the playoffs since results are not decided until January or February.

Futures typically include championship results, conference and division projections, season honors races, and overall team wins. The first lines often appear shortly after the previous Super Bowl and reflect preseason expectations, schedule analysis and roster updates.

Futures lock tokens for several months, so users should weigh time horizons and entertainment value before participating. These markets increase engagement throughout the season, but require patience, especially when projections change due to injuries, roster changes and midseason trends.

Many NFL betting sites use various incentives to attract and retain users during the football season, especially during the start of the football season in September and the playoff rounds in January. Many bookmakers offer a welcome bonus and therefore promotional activity increases at the start of the NFL season in September and then during the playoff periods in January.

Platforms use these offers to attract new users, often through first bet insurance or deposit matches. Understanding how these features work will help you appreciate their true value, rather than relying on a superficial understanding.

Common structures include welcome packages tied to your first bet, enhanced lines on select games, and ongoing rewards for regular participation. A typical offer may combine the initial bet with bonus bets or provide additional game tokens after a qualifying action.

Some platforms have Bet and Get formats that return bonus bets regardless of the outcome. Weekly promotions may include increased profits from bets on the same games or prime time matches structured by individualbookmakers

Most bonuses include conditions. Bonus tokens often expire within specified time limits, require certain participation thresholds, and may include maximum conversion limits. Bonus bets are usually non-removable and the bet is removed from any value returned. Promotional codes may be required to redeem certain offers.

Reading full promotional terms and conditions is especially important during Week 1, Thanksgiving, and Conference Championships. Understanding the requirements avoids confusion regarding how tokens are unlocked or expire.

Participation at any NFL betting site is subject to state laws and users must verify eligibility before creating an account. Licensed platforms in states such as New York, New Jersey, Ohio and Pennsylvania use identity verification, age verification, geolocation and encrypted connections to comply with regulatory requirements.

Official gaming commission websites list authorized operators, and regulated sites display licensing information in the footers. These measures provide protection that unregulated alternatives do not provide.

Users should also confirm basic safety rules. Look for "https" in the web address, optional two-factor authentication, strong and unique passwords, verified domain names or app listings, and avoid links from unfamiliar sources.

Rules may change from one NFL season to the next, so check the current rules for 2026 campaigns, especially if you are traveling or relocating. Please review the latest NFL Campaign Rules 2026 before participating, especially if you are traveling interstate or moving to a new jurisdiction.

Playing on any NFL betting site should remain fun. Clear boundaries help prevent activities beyond your intended use. Regulated platforms provide responsible gaming tools in account settings, including session reminders, token limits, bet limits, cool-off periods and full self-exclusion. These controls help users structure participation throughout the season. Setting a specific budget before the first week and consistently applying it later in the playoffs, such as the playoffs, reduces the number of unplanned decisions.

It is important to recognize the early signs of problem behavior. Warning signs include chasing losses, hiding activities, neglecting responsibilities, stress related to results, using borrowed or necessary funds, or feeling unable to stop. Support is available through national and government services that provide confidential advice.
